How Do I Convert 3/4 Cup to mL?
Quick explanation
Use this page when a recipe calls for 3/4 cup and you want a direct mL value instead of checking the cup line by eye. The answer is 187.5 mL in Metric mode or about 177.4 mL in US mode. Calculation steps
How to convert 3/4 cup to mL exactly
mL = cups × cup-size-in-mL
For this page, cups = 0.75. Use 250 mL for Metric cup and 236.588 mL for US cup.
Practical kitchen rounding
3/4 cup ~ 188 mL (Metric) or 177 mL (US)
Nearest 1 mL is usually sufficient for daily cooking; stay on one cup standard through the recipe.
Worked example (this page)
Input: 0.75
Metric: 0.75 x 250 = 187.5 mL; US: 0.75 x 236.588 = 177.44 mL.
Practical: use 188 mL (Metric) or 177 mL (US).
About these units
Why cup values differ
Cup values vary by region, so 3/4 cup is not one universal mL result.
- Metric cup = 250 mL (common in metric-standard recipe sources).
- US cup = 236.588 mL (common in US recipe sources).

How many mL is 3/4 cup?
3/4 cup is 187.5 mL in Metric mode and 177.4 mL in US mode.
Why do I get two answers for 3/4 cup?
Because cup size differs by standard: Metric cup is 250 mL, while US cup is 236.588 mL.
